Output b31f8d32cd30c7c85d5ddd03a3d417f3de4b219f95995e62fe67d177e856b4b5:858

value
104665335
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98d8566bd85c6281e41eb3aa45c6d86afe0a6a87 OP_EQUAL
address
MMqL6zDCmKkSiX4BQtGjwZbTr1fFnVfFqV
transaction
b31f8d32cd30c7c85d5ddd03a3d417f3de4b219f95995e62fe67d177e856b4b5
spent
true